Iraqi-American Kadhim Alzubaidy makes the best damned baba ganouch in
the city (and a mighty fine falafel to boot). The best thing about
getting lunch at Falafel King is watching the blur of his hands as he
makes the sandwiches, even while he’s chatting everyone up and offering
falafel samples. I’ve also seen him give huge discounts to the local
homeless.
